DELL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2018 in Review

651 of the 4,364 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Dell (DELL) for Q1 2018, worth a combined $13B — down 9.6% from $14.4B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 90 funds closed out of DELL and 83 opened new positions — a net loss of 7 holders — while 236 trimmed existing stakes and 179 added.

The largest buyer was Pentwater Capital Management, adding an estimated $316M. The largest seller was D.E. Shaw & Co, cutting an estimated $486M.
